Which of the following levels of teaching involves the highest order thinking skills?

A.

Memory level

B.

Understanding level

C.

Reflective level

D.

All levels involve similar thinking skills

Correct option is C

Reflective level involves the highest order thinking skills among the options provided. The levels of teaching are often categorized based on Bloom's Taxonomy, which includes six levels: Knowledge (memory), Comprehension (understanding), Application, Analysis, Synthesis, and Evaluation. Reflective level corresponds to the Evaluation and Synthesis stages, which require students to critically analyze and synthesize information, make judgments, and reflect on their learning. These levels demand more complex cognitive processes, such as critical thinking, problem-solving, and the ability to form well-reasoned arguments.
